Heat stop Hornets' 6-game winning streak behind 33 points from Tyler Herro

Tyler Herro had 33 points, nine rebounds and nine assists and the Miami Heat snapped the Charlotte Hornets’ six-game winning streak with a 128-120 victory Friday night

Myron Gardner - Starting Friday Gardner will start Friday against the Hornets, Ira Winderman of the South Florida Sun Sentinel reports.
Impact Gardner is getting a spot-start with both Norman Powell (groin) and Andrew Wiggins (knee) unavailable, and he'll be joined in the first unit by Davion Mitchell, Tyler Herro, Pelle Larsson and Bam Adebayo. Across four starts this season, Gardner has posted averages of 11.0 points, 8.5 rebounds, 2.3 assists, 1.8 triples and 1.8 steals per contest.

Dru Smith - Good to go vs. Charlotte Smith (ankle) is available for Friday's game against the Hornets.
Impact Smith popped up on the injury report as probable due to left ankle soreness. As expected, he's been cleared to play in Friday's road tilt and could see a bump in minutes due to the absences of Norman Powell (groin), Andrew Wiggins (knee) and Nikola Jovic (back).

Andrew Wiggins - Won't play Friday Wiggins (knee) has been ruled out for Friday's game against the Hornets.
Impact Wiggins is working through bilateral knee tendinitis, so he'll sit for the second leg of the Heat's back-to-back set and hope to be available for Sunday's game against the Pistons. Kel'el Ware, Pelle Larsson and Myron Gardner are all candidates to enter Miami's starting lineup in Wiggins' absence.
